NCR APTRA Advance NDC (NCR Direct Connect) is the industry-standard software architecture used to connect Automated Teller Machines (ATMs) to central host banking networks. Operating as a state-driven emulation protocol, it translates standardized host commands into physical hardware actions like dispensing cash, reading cards, and printing receipts.
